Conquering the Housing Market: Tips for First-Time Buyers
Purchasing your maiden home is an thrilling milestone, but navigating the housing market can feel overwhelming. Don't worry, with a little preparation, you can triumphantly navigate this process. Start by investigating the local market to grasp prices, movements, and accessible properties.
It's crucial to obtain pre-approval for a mortgage prior to you start actively house hunting. This will offer you a clear idea of your acquisition power and make the process smoother when you find the ideal home.
Consider these additional tips:
- Work with a realtor who is skilled in your desired area.
- Remain focused; the right home may take some time to surface.
- Don't overextend yourself financially. Set a budget and stick to it.
With sufficient here preparation, you can confidently navigate the housing market and accomplish your dream of homeownership.
Unlocking Equity: Strategies for Homeowners
For homeowners eager to maximize the equity built within their homes, a range of innovative approaches are available. One popular option is a home equity loan, which allows you to borrow against your existing equity for renovations, debt consolidation or other financial aspirations. Refinancing your mortgage can also be a viable option, potentially lowering your monthly payments and unlocking considerable savings over time. Exploring government-backed programs like the Home Equity Conversion Mortgage (HECM) can provide older homeowners with access to cash flow without having to sell their homes.
- It is crucial to carefully research and evaluate different loan options to determine the best fit for your individual circumstances.
- Consult a trusted financial advisor to discuss your financial goals and develop a personalized equity approach.
- Remember, wise borrowing practices are essential to avoid overextending yourself financially.
